How Does a 3D Printer Laser Engraver Work?

To understand how the works, let’s break it down into its core components and functions:

  • Laser Source: The heart of the device is the laser source, which emits a highly focused beam of light. This beam is powerful enough to cut through or engrave various materials without causing damage to surrounding areas.
  • Control System: The control system allows users to input designs, patterns, or text using a computer or built-in interface. Advanced software ensures precise alignment and execution of the desired design.
  • Material Handling: The device is designed to accommodate different materials, including metal, plexiglass, and plastics. Its adjustable bed ensures that even uneven surfaces can be engraved with ease.

The process begins by uploading your design to the control system. Once the design is set, the laser beam follows the programmed path, cutting or engraving the material as specified. The result is a polished finish that requires minimal post-processing.

Choosing the Right 3D Printer Laser Engraver

If you’re considering purchasing a , there are several factors to keep in mind:

  • Material Compatibility: Ensure the device can handle the types of materials you plan to work with.
  • Laser Power: Higher power lasers are better suited for thicker or harder materials, while lower power lasers are ideal for delicate projects.
  • User Interface: Look for a device with an intuitive control system that makes it easy to input and execute designs.
  • Budget: Consider your budget when choosing between different models, as prices can vary widely based on features and capabilities.

Maintenance and Safety Tips

To ensure optimal performance and longevity of your , follow these maintenance and safety tips:

  • Regular Cleaning: Clean the device regularly to prevent dust and debris from affecting performance.
  • Lens Care: Keep the laser lens clean to ensure maximum efficiency and accuracy.
  • Proper Ventilation: Use the device in a well-ventilated area to avoid inhaling fumes produced during engraving.
  • Safety Gear: Always wear appropriate safety gear, including goggles and gloves, when operating the device.
